Central defender of Plymouth Maksym Talovyerov spoke about his transfer to an English club.
Maksym Talovyerov— There were also rumors in the media that you were negotiating a special clause in the contract in case Plymouth was relegated. Could you partially reveal what it was about?
— According to the contract, I cannot disclose its details, but I prefer to think positively and how to rise higher in the table. This is exactly why I came to help Plymouth and will make every effort.
— Did you consult with anyone from the national team regarding the transfer? Maybe with Serhii Rebrov?
— Everything happened quite quickly and intensively, so there wasn't enough time. I didn't communicate with the coach, but I remember that he played in England — both in the Premier League and in the Championship, so he knows well the quality of English football.
I believe that right now the national team has very important playoff matches of the Nations League, for which preparations are underway — that's why the head coach and staff are busy with the national team matters, not with the clubs of the players. My main task is to ensure that the level of play meets the requirements of the coaching staff and the national team of Ukraine.
